Rumah Pangsa Menglembu in Kinta, Perak recorded 32 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, sized between 675 and 724 sqft, with a median price of RM65K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M91.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M65K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M48K to RM82K, and a typical market range of RM53K to RM77K.

Most transactions involved low-cost flat, with minimal variety in property types.

Price per square foot shows a median of RM91, though individual units vary from RM67 to RM114 in the core range. The broader market spans RM69.06 to RM112.56, indicating diverse property characteristics. A wider spread (IQR: RM43.50) and deviation (MAD: RM24) indicate significant PSF variations, likely due to diverse property types or conditions.
